Transaction 9913c6b6f0a3836496c5324a106e1da73e07a01186931a9b9bb28913e22119d5
1 Input
1 Output
-
9913c6b6f0a3836496c5324a106e1da73e07a01186931a9b9bb28913e22119d5:0
- value
- 499359486
- script pubkey
- OP_0 OP_PUSHBYTES_20 23c69f68363579c57f63cb6638d5197066d81d70
- address
- bc1qy0rf76pkx4uu2lmrednr34gewpnds8tsd2gm8x